Preliminary First Amendment win for Texas professor

AUSTIN, Texas — Texas State University philosophy professor Idris Robinson won a preliminary injunction ordering the university to reinstate him to his position as a tenure-track assistant professor. The university declined to renew his contract after people complained that he gave a speech titled “Strategic Lessons from the Palestinian Resistance” in Asheville, North Carolina.
